Climate Overview

🇺🇸

Midland

Midland in the Permian Basin of West Texas is the petroleum capital of America. The flat, treeless Permian Basin has an extreme semi-arid climate with intense summer heat and significant wind year-round. Dust storms are frequent and the city sits at 2,779 feet with dry air that makes 100°F temperatures somewhat more bearable than humid East Texas.

🇰🇷

Seoul

Humid continental — hot humid summers, cold dry winters, beautiful spring and fall

Best monthsApril, May, September, October
AvoidJuly, August (monsoon), December, January (bitter cold)
Annual rain57 inches (1,450 mm)

Seoul has four distinct seasons. Cherry blossoms in April and autumn foliage in October rival Tokyo's. Summers bring the monsoon (jangma) and intense heat; winters are dry and bitterly cold with clear blue skies.
